Food in 24 Solar Terms24节气养生法
Feb.3-5 立春 Spring Begins
春天开始,天气回暖,万物复苏。春属木,与肝相应,有生发特性。饮食调养方面要顾护肝气,宜食辛甘发散之品,不宜食酸收之味。
Beginning of spring,temprature rises and nature wakes. Spring belongs to Wood in the Five Elements, correspongding to Liver in the Five Internal Organs, more pungent food and less acidic food to care liver.

夏日美食:夏至面 Xiazhi Noodle
In summer, Chinese likes to eat cold noodles. On June 21st, people across the Northern hemisphere celebrate the longest day and shortest night of the year, but residents of China also observe an ancient tradition—eating noodles!?The old saying really sums it up: “the days start to get shorter after eating noodles” (吃过夏至面,一天短一线。Chīguò xiàzhìmiàn , yì tiān duǎn yí xiàn). ?Sales of nutritious cold noodles will hit the roof as people take steps to improve their eating habits during the summer solstice, known here as “Xiazhi.” Another saying, “eat dumplings for the winter solstice and eat noodles for the summer solstice” (冬至馄饨夏至面。Dōnɡzhì húntun Xiàzhìmiàn.) should be a reminder. Like many Chinese holidays, this festival has ancient, agricultural roots. Long ago, fresh harvests would be ceremoniously offered to the gods at this time of year. And though we may not be farmers, we can still recognize this annual cycle, this changing of seasons, in our own way—by reverentially eating a bowl of noodles.
